Paris


Bonjour,

Paris is beautiful have been eating loads of french pastries (creme volae was my favourite) and drinking french wine.

Wednesday night we went out for dinner at a lovely french restaurant with some friends from London over looking the Eiffel Tower. We did order snails, however they never arrived.

Thursday I went and seen the Arc De Triomphe and walked down Champs Elysees, the shopping was fantastic I bought a pair of black sexy shoes and a Morgan hand bag. I found a lovely pair of Channel Sunglasses, unfortunately they were a little out of my budget hehe.

Thursday night we went up the Eiffel Tower at sun set and looked down over thousands of white buildings, as it got darker the buildings became pretty sparkling city lights (it was breath taking). When we got to the bottom of the Tower it sparkled like a Christmas tree (it was beautiful).

Friday went to Disneyland Paris for my birthday and seen mickey mouse! My favourite was Fantacyland where we went through 'Its a small world' and went on the 'Mad Hatters Tea Cups'. We also went on some exciting rides in Adventureland like Pirates of the Caribbean (it was fantastic).
